**Action item (P1, owner: on-call):** During the Flintmere incident we flew blind for 40 minutes because the VRAM profiler on the Quillback training nodes was sampling way too coarsely to catch the fragmentation spike. Please wire up the new `memtrace` agent on every Quillback host and bump sampling so we actually see allocator churn before OOMs land. Don't guess at the knobs — Priya from the Gristle team already tuned these on staging and they held up fine. Use the following constants verbatim.

constants for bagag-fawip:
BUDGETS = {
    "wenius": 400,
    "brieth": 224,
    "rusath": 783,
    "eliys": 187,
    "aldax": 737,
    "ralion": 818,
    "istius": 153,
}

Team,

The Brimford ledger cut-over finished last night without incident. All write traffic now lands in month-partitioned tables, with the legacy monolithic table frozen as read-only until the verification window closes. Row counts reconciled exactly across all twelve backfilled partitions, and query latency on the reporting path dropped roughly 40%. Retention jobs will begin pruning partitions older than 36 months starting next week. For reference, the partitioning service is now running with the following settings.

service settings:
[ulair]
team = praath
access_code = ac_06d704
owner = wenix.ulair
host = ulair.qirvancorp.corp
port = 9200
peer = sorys.nelvronet.internal
salt = 2668132c
pin = 9140

## Data Stores — Snackloop Restock Planner

Quick tour for when you get paged. Snackloop keeps machine inventory snapshots in the planner DB, route schedules in a separate scheduler store, and a small Redis cache for the driver app. Ninety percent of incidents trace back to the planner DB — stale snapshots, stuck restock jobs, that kind of thing. Check `snackctl jobs --stuck` first; if jobs are wedged, you'll need direct DB access. Connect to the planner database with the following string.

replica DSN, bahof-kajog: clickhouse://casox_svc:OPMtdnN@db-cb4e.plorvahq.local:5432/ulair